Vacuum Virtues
Rathey, Allen
American School & University, v79 n9 p43-47 Apr 2007
Upright vacuums, like cars, vary in quality, features and performance. Like automobiles, some uprights are reliable, others may be problematic, and some become a problem as a result of neglect or improper use. So, how do education institutions make an informed choice and, having done so, ensure that an upright vacuum goes the distance? In this article, the author provides the "under-the-hood" facts and long-term issues that custodial departments at education institutions have to consider when evaluating their upright vacuum.
